About Welingkar Institute
Legacy and Background
The Prin. L.N. Established in
1977 in Mumbai under the aegis of the S.P. Mandali Trust, one of India’s oldest
educational trusts, Welingkar Institute of Management Development &
Research (WeSchool) has, over the past four decades, evolved into a leading
B-school known for combining strong academic foundations with real-world
industry exposure.
In 2008, Welingkar expanded
its presence by opening a state-of-the-art campus in Bangalore, catering to the
growing demand for management education in South India. Both campuses are
strategically located in corporate hubs, giving students direct exposure to
industries and organizations.
Campuses: Mumbai and Bangalore
Mumbai Campus:
Situated in the financial capital of India, the Mumbai campus is known for its
modern infrastructure, including simulation labs, innovation labs, and
design-thinking spaces. Its proximity to corporate headquarters allows students
to engage with top companies for projects, internships, and placements.
Bangalore Campus: Established
in 2008, this campus focuses on emerging areas like business analytics,
e-business, and technology-driven management. The campus is located in the IT
hub of India, offering direct industry connections with top tech firms and
startups.

Eligibility Criteria
To apply for the PGDM programs
at Welingkar (Mumbai and Bangalore campuses), candidates must meet the
following requirements:
Educational Qualification:
Applicants must hold a bachelor’s degree in any discipline from a recognized
university with at least 50% marks (45% for candidates from reserved
categories).
Final Year Students: Candidates
in their final year of graduation may also apply, provided they submit proof of
completion by the admission deadline.
Entrance Exam Scores:
Applicants must have a valid score in one of the following exams:
·
CAT 2024 (conducted by IIMs)
·
XAT 2025 (conducted by XLRI)
·
CMAT 2025 (conducted by NTA)
·
GMAT (taken between January 2022 and December
2024)
·
ATMA 2025 or MAH-CET 2025

Selection Process
The selection process at
Welingkar is multi-stage and includes:
1.Shortlisting
·
Based on entrance exam scores, academic
performance, work experience (if any), and application details.
·
A shortlist is prepared for the next stage.
2.Group Discussion / Group
Activity
·
Shortlisted candidates participate in
activities designed to evaluate their teamwork, communication, critical
thinking, and leadership skills.
3.Personal Interview (PI)
·
A one-on-one interview conducted by faculty and
industry experts.
·
Focuses on academic background, career
aspirations, industry awareness, and personal strengths.
4.Final Merit List
·
Prepared based on a composite score of:
·
Entrance Exam Score
·
Academic Record
·
Work Experience (if any)
·
GD/PI Performance

Courses Offered at Welingkar
Institute (Mumbai & Bangalore)
Welingkar Institute (WeSchool)
is widely recognized for its diverse and innovative programs in management.
Unlike many B-schools that focus only on traditional MBA/PGDM courses,
Welingkar has designed specialized programs that align with evolving industry
needs — such as E-Business, Business Design, Retail, Healthcare, and Rural
Management.
Here’s a detailed breakdown:
Flagship Program: Post
Graduate Diploma in Management (PGDM)
·
Duration: 2
years, full-time, AICTE-approved.
·
Campus: Offered at both Mumbai
and Bangalore campuses.
Overview: The
PGDM program is Welingkar’s flagship offering, aimed at providing a strong
foundation in management principles with the flexibility to specialize in key
areas.
Specializations Available:
·
Marketing
·
Finance
·
Human Resources (HR)
·
Operations
·
Business Analytics
Specialized PGDM Programs
(Mumbai Campus Only)
1.PGDM in E-Business
·
Focus: The intersection of business and digital
technologies.
·
Covers e-commerce, digital business strategies,
and technology-driven solutions.
2.PGDM in Business Design
·
Focus: Integrates design thinking into
management education.
·
Students learn to apply creativity and
innovation in solving business problems.
·
Focus: Advanced data-driven decision-making.
·
Trains students in business intelligence,
predictive analytics, and big data tools.
3.PGDM in Healthcare
Management
·
Focus:Prepares professionals for the healthcare
and hospital management sector.
·
Combines management studies with
healthcare-specific knowledge.
4.PGDM in Retail Management
·
Focus: Management of retail operations, supply
chains, and consumer behavior.
·
Designed for careers in the booming retail and
FMCG sectors.
5.PGDM in Rural Management
(Emerging Economies)
·
Focus: Development of rural markets and
sustainable businesses.
·
Ideal for students interested in agribusiness,
rural entrepreneurship, and development consultancy.
Part-Time and Executive
Programs
·
Part-Time Master’s Programs (MMS Equivalent):
Offered in Marketing, Finance, HR, and Information Systems.
·
Executive PGDM: Designed for working
professionals with managerial experience.
Global Exposure Programs
·
Welingkar has tie-ups with international
universities across the USA, UK, Canada, and Europe.
·
Students participate in exchange programs,
global immersions, and study tours.
Doctoral Program
·
Ph.D. in Management Studies: For candidates
interested in academic research, teaching, or policy-making in business and
management.
Fees Structure 2025 at
Welingkar Institute (Mumbai & Bangalore)
When choosing a B-school, the
fee structure plays a vital role alongside placements and academic reputation.
Welingkar Institute offers an excellent balance of quality education at a
competitive cost compared to many other top private B-schools in India.
Here’s a detailed breakdown:
Fees for Full-Time PGDM
Programs (Mumbai Campus)
For the academic session
2025–27, the fee structure (approximate, subject to revision) is:
·
PGDM (Flagship): ₹14–15 Lakhs (for 2 years)
·
PGDM E-Business: ₹14–15 Lakhs
·
PGDM Business Design: ₹14–15 Lakhs
·
PGDM Healthcare Management: ₹14–15 Lakhs
·
PGDM Research & Business Analytics: ₹14–15
Lakhs
·
PGDM Retail Management: ₹14–15 Lakhs
·
PGDM Rural Management (Emerging Economies):
₹14–15 Lakhs
All Mumbai campus PGDM
programs have a similar fee range, reflecting uniformity in cost regardless of
specialization.
Fees for Full-Time PGDM
Program (Bangalore Campus)
PGDM (General): Around ₹12–13
Lakhs (for 2 years)
The Bangalore campus is
relatively more affordable compared to Mumbai, while still providing quality
education and strong industry exposure.
Part-Time & Executive
Programs Fees
·
Part-Time Master’s Programs (MMS Equivalent):
₹2–3 Lakhs (approx.)
·
Executive PGDM: ₹5–6 Lakhs (depending on
specialization and duration)
These programs are designed
for working professionals seeking career advancement without leaving their
jobs.
Doctoral Program Fees
Ph.D. in Management Studies:
₹3–4 Lakhs (varies depending on research area and duration).
Additional Costs
·
Hostel & Accommodation:
·
Mumbai: ₹1.5–2.5 Lakhs per year (depending on
location and facilities).
·
Bangalore: ₹1–1.8 Lakhs per year.
·
Food & Living Expenses: ₹8,000–₹12,000 per
month (approx.).
·
Study Tours / International Exchange: Optional,
additional cost depending on destination and duration.

Cutoff 2025 at Welingkar
Institute (Mumbai & Bangalore)
Admission to Welingkar
Institute (WeSchool) is highly competitive, as it attracts candidates from
across India. The cutoff scores vary by campus, program, and entrance exam.
While the Mumbai campus generally has higher cutoffs due to its long-standing
reputation and location advantage, the Bangalore campus maintains slightly
lower cutoffs, making it more accessible.
Entrance Exams Accepted
Welingkar considers scores
from multiple national-level entrance exams:
·
CAT 2024 (for 2025 admission)
·
XAT 2025
·
CMAT 2025
·
MAH CET 2025
·
ATMA 2025
·
GMAT (2022–2024 scores)
Expected Cutoffs for 2025
Admission
Mumbai Campus (Higher Cutoffs)
·
CAT: 80–85 percentile
·
XAT: 80–85 percentile
·
CMAT: 95–97 percentile
·
MAH CET: 98–99 percentile (especially for
Maharashtra students)
·
ATMA: 85–90 percentile
·
GMAT: 600+ score
Bangalore Campus (Moderate
Cutoffs)
·
CAT: 70–75 percentile
·
XAT: 70–75 percentile
·
CMAT: 85–90 percentile
·
MAH CET: 90–95 percentile
·
ATMA: 75–80 percentile
·
GMAT: 550+ score
Factors Affecting Cutoffs
The cutoff scores for
Welingkar vary each year based on multiple factors:
1.Number of Applicants:
Higher applications push cutoffs upward.
2.Exam Difficulty Level:
Tougher exams often result in slightly lower cutoffs.
3.Seats Available: Limited
intake in specialized programs (like Business Design, Rural Management) can
raise cutoffs.
4.Campus Preference:
Mumbai’s corporate exposure attracts higher demand, leading to higher cutoffs
than Bangalore.
5.Diversity Consideration:
Welingkar encourages applications from diverse academic backgrounds, which may
affect cutoff flexibility.
Key Takeaway
·
For Mumbai campus, aim for CAT/XAT 85
percentile+ or CMAT 95+ percentile to be competitive.
·
For Bangalore campus, CAT/XAT 75 percentile+ or
CMAT 85+ percentile is a realistic target.

Placement 2025 at Welingkar
Institute (WeSchool)
One of the biggest strengths
of Welingkar Institute of Management is its robust placement track record. Both
the Mumbai and Bangalore campuses enjoy strong corporate connect, ensuring
students secure internships and final placements across diverse industries.
Placement Highlights (Batch
2024–25)
While official placement
reports for the 2025 batch will be released later, based on past years and
current hiring trends, here are the expected highlights:
·
Highest CTC (Mumbai Campus): ₹25–27 LPA
(Domestic)
·
Average CTC (Mumbai Campus): ₹12–14 LPA
·
Median CTC (Mumbai Campus): ₹10–11 LPA
·
Highest CTC (Bangalore Campus): ₹18–20 LPA
·
Average CTC (Bangalore Campus): ₹9–10 LPA
·
Top 20% Students (Mumbai): Average CTC around
₹16–18 LPA
The consistent rise in average
packages shows the increasing trust recruiters have in WeSchool graduates.
Top Recruiting Sectors
·
Welingkar’s strength lies in offering diverse
opportunities across multiple industries:
·
Consulting & Advisory: Deloitte, EY, PwC,
KPMG, Accenture Strategy.
· Banking & Financial Services (BFSI):
Leading recruiters include HDFC Bank, ICICI Bank, Axis Bank, Citi, HSBC, and
Kotak Mahindra, offering roles across retail banking, corporate finance, wealth
management, and investment services.
·
IT & Technology: Infosys, TCS, Wipro, HCL,
Capgemini, Tech Mahindra, Cognizant.
·
FMCG & Retail: HUL, ITC, Nestlé, Marico,
Dabur, Godrej Consumer, BigBasket, Flipkart, Amazon.
·
Pharma & Healthcare: Cipla, Dr. Reddy’s,
Johnson & Johnson, Novartis.
·
Startups & E-commerce: Ola, Swiggy, Zomato,
Paytm, BYJU’S.
Popular Job Roles Offered
·
Students at WeSchool secure diverse roles
across functions:
·
Marketing & Sales: Brand
Manager, Digital Marketing Executive, Business Development Manager.
·
Finance Roles:
Career opportunities include positions such as Investment Banking Analyst,
Equity Research Associate, Risk Analyst, and Wealth Manager.
·
Consulting:
Business Analyst, Strategy Consultant, Advisory Associate.
· Operations & Supply Chain Roles: Graduates
can pursue careers as Operations Managers, Logistics Analysts, and Procurement
Managers, focusing on process efficiency, resource optimization, and end-to-end
supply chain management.
·
Human Resources: HR
Business Partner, Talent Acquisition Specialist, Learning & Development
Manager.
·
IT/Analytics: Data
Analyst, Business Intelligence Consultant, Product Manager.
Summer Internships
·
Summer Internships are an integral part of the
PGDM curriculum at Welingkar. Some highlights:
·
Stipend Range:
₹20,000 – ₹1.2 lakh per month (depending on sector and company).
·
Key Recruiters: Deloitte,
Infosys, HUL, Nestlé, ICICI Bank, Amazon, and startups.
·
Many students convert their summer internships
into Pre-Placement Offers (PPOs).
Alumni Network Advantage
·
With over 25,000+ alumni across the globe,
Welingkar provides students access to a powerful network of professionals.
·
Alumni play a vital role in mentoring,
recruiting, and guiding students into leadership roles.
